Isaac 0 moves from prototype into California homes
Weave Robotics began limited California shipments of its stationary laundry-folding robot, giving the category a rare example of real household deployment.

Weave Robotics opened limited California deployment for Isaac 0, a stationary robot built specifically to fold laundry at a table.
The narrow task makes Isaac 0 useful evidence for domestic robotics: it gives up generality in exchange for repeated real-world work. Weave now reports thousands of field hours and substantial weekly laundry volume.
